1 On Fri, 25 Feb 2022 at 10:00, Dr Rainer Woitok <rainer.woitok@×××××.com> wrote:
2 > A quick search in the "emerge" manual page for "pars" and "pip" did not
3 > turn up anything I considered relevant. Can anyone give more hints?
4
5 I'm guessing any proposed solution would fail when what you want to
6 capture has an interactive component like this.
7
8 My solution would rather be to run your emerge commands in a place
9 that would give you the scroll-back that you lack now, such as in a
10 screen session. It feels like something like a screen session would be
11 potentially beneficial in more ways as well, such as being able to do
12 this remotely.
